Edward Ingram, 2nd Viscount Irvine (1663–1668), succeeded his father Henry Ingram, 1st Viscount of Irvine at the age of 4. He died without issue in 1688, and was succeeded by his brother, Arthur. [1][2] He was buried at Whitkirk in Yorkshire on the 17th of October. [3]His will that was written on 22 August 1688 was proven at London on the 19th of November.[3]
